Karan Adani and Former CFO B Ravi Settle PMC Projects Case With SEBI for Rs 13.65 Lakh Each

The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) has disposed of adjudication proceedings against Adani Ports and Special Economic Zone Ltd (APSEZ) Managing Director Karan Adani and the company's former Chief Financial Officer B Ravi after both individuals remitted ₹13.65 lakh each as a settlement fee.

The regulatory matter was concluded under the SEBI (Settlement Proceedings) Regulations, 2018, allowing both executives to resolve the adjudication without admitting or denying the findings of facts and conclusions of law. In an exchange disclosure, APSEZ clarified that there is no financial impact on the company arising out of the settlement order.

Genesis of the Regulatory Action

The proceedings originated from an investigation conducted by the capital markets regulator into banking transactions and inter-corporate security deposits involving PMC Projects (India) Private Limited, APSEZ, and the port operator's subsidiaries.

The market regulator had alleged non-compliance with the provisions of:

  • The Securities Contracts (Regulation) Act, 1956 (SCRA)
  • The SEBI Act, 1992
  • Regulation 17(8) of the S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015 (LODR), which mandates that the Chief Executive Officer and Chief Financial Officer provide necessary compliance and financial certification to the board of directors

SEBI initially issued a show-cause notice to both executives on November 22, 2023, asking why an inquiry should not be conducted and why penalties should not be imposed.

Timeline of the Settlement Process

Legal representatives from Cyril Amarchand Mangaldas filed replies to the show-cause notices in January 2024 and submitted settlement applications under the established consent framework.

Key Procedural Milestones:

  • May 8 and July 15, 2024: Meetings were held between the applicants' representatives and SEBI's Internal Committee to deliberate on the settlement terms.
  • June 29, 2026: SEBI's High Powered Advisory Committee (HPAC) evaluated the proposals and recommended settling the matter on payment of ₹13.65 lakh per applicant.
  • August 13, 2026: A panel of SEBI Whole-Time Members formally approved the HPAC recommendations.
  • September 5, 2026: Both applicants completed the remittance of ₹13.65 lakh each, totaling ₹27.30 lakh.
  • September 10, 2026: SEBI Adjudicating Officer Jai Sebastian issued the order disposing of the proceedings under Section 15JB of the SEBI Act and Section 23JA of the SCRA.

Significance for Market Participants

Transactions involving PMC Projects had previously come under regulatory scrutiny following allegations raised in early 2023. For institutional and retail investors tracking APSEZ, India's largest private port operator, the closure of these legacy regulatory proceedings helps clear compliance uncertainties surrounding key executive personnel, resolving governance questions that had remained open since the 2023 notices.
